Concerns for welfare of man on bridge see police shut stretch of Avon Causeway at Hurn
Police shut a stretch of the busy Avon Causeway at Hurn today as they responded to concerns for the welfare of a man on a nearby bridge.
Called out shortly after 11am, officers were joined by paramedics and firefighters at the scene.
The closures were put in place around 11.15am and lifted around midday once the man had been “taken to receive the appropriate care”.
A Dorset Police spokesperson said: “We received a report at 11.04am on Monday 20th January 2025 raising concern for the welfare of a man on a bridge in the area of Avon Causeway.
“Officers attended alongside the fire and ambulance services and road closures were put in place.
“The man was taken to receive the appropriate care.”
Fire crews from Christchurch and Springbourne responded but were not needed on arrival.
